This projector from DreamVision utilizes DLP technology, achieving 3460 ANSI lumens and a contrast of 4300:1 at a resolution of HDTV 1280×720 Pixel. The manufacturer rates the durability of the included lamp at 1500 hours. Regarding setup flexibility, the model features an optical lens shift function alongside digital keystone correction, allowing for precise alignment without distortion. The specifications identify the device as a model with an interchangeable lens option. Matching optional optics allow for exact adaptation to the required image size and projection distance, which can be calculated directly with the Projector Calculator. A look at the light output reveals: The 3460 ANSI lumens are sufficient to illuminate an image width of up to 598 cm in darkened rooms. If room light is present, we recommend not exceeding a maximum width of 399 cm. Regarding signal processing, the model is compatible with incoming 1080P content. A look at the data sheet confirms a very subtle fan noise for the projector at just 28 decibels. This model dates back to 2004 and is no longer part of DreamVision's current product range.
